Chirnside Station is a small and peaceful rural hamlet set amidst the rolling countryside of the Scottish Borders, offering an idyllic setting for those seeking a quieter pace of life while remaining well connected. Located just a short distance from the village of Chirnside, the area enjoys a strong sense of community alongside convenient access to everyday amenities.

Chirnside itself provides a range of local facilities including shops, a primary school, healthcare services, and a selection of cafés and traditional pubs, catering well for day-to-day needs. The village is perhaps best known as the birthplace of David Hume, adding a touch of historical interest to the area.

The surrounding Borders countryside is renowned for its natural beauty, with open farmland, gentle hills, and scenic walking and cycling routes right on the doorstep. The nearby River Tweed is particularly popular for fishing and outdoor recreation, while the dramatic Berwickshire coastline, including St Abbs and St Abb's Head, lies within easy reach and offers stunning coastal views and wildlife.

For a wider range of amenities, the historic market town of Duns is a short drive away, while the larger town of Berwick-upon-Tweed provides extensive shopping, leisure facilities, and mainline rail links to Edinburgh, Newcastle upon Tyne, and beyond.

Combining rural charm with accessibility, Chirnside Station and its surrounding area offer an appealing lifestyle for commuters, families, and those looking to enjoy the best of the Scottish Borders countryside.
